Can you share some real life Indian cultural experiences?

3 answers
2024-12-13 21:44

Sure. One amazing cultural experience in India is the celebration of Diwali. It's the festival of lights. People clean their homes, decorate with colorful rangolis at the entrance, and light up diyas (oil lamps). Families gather, exchange gifts, and there are spectacular firework displays. It's a time of joy, renewal, and togetherness.

Can you share some Indian cultural stories about digestion?

1 answer
2024-12-01 03:19

In Indian folklore, there are tales of how certain foods were discovered to be good for digestion. For instance, ginger has long been known in Indian culture for its digestive properties. Legend has it that ancient sages found that ginger could soothe the stomach and aid in the digestion process. This knowledge has been passed down through generations, and ginger is still widely used in Indian cooking and herbal remedies for digestion problems.

Can you share some real Indian stories about cultural traditions?

3 answers
2024-11-16 09:47

Sure. One such story is about Diwali. It is the festival of lights. Legend has it that Lord Rama returned to Ayodhya after 14 years of exile, and the people lit diyas (oil lamps) to welcome him. This tradition continues today, with people lighting up their homes, exchanging gifts, and having feasts.

Can you share some family Indian cultural stories?

3 answers
2024-12-13 04:01

One interesting family Indian cultural story is about the celebration of Diwali. In families, they clean their homes thoroughly to welcome the goddess of wealth, Lakshmi. They light diyas (oil lamps) all around the house, which symbolizes the victory of light over darkness. Family members come together, exchange gifts, and prepare special sweets like ladoo and barfi. It's a time of joy, unity, and celebration of family values.

Can you share some new Indian cultural stories?

1 answer
2024-11-28 16:19

The story of Krishna is also very popular in Indian culture. Krishna is often depicted as a mischievous and wise god. His stories include his childhood pranks, his role in the great war in the Mahabharata, and his teachings on love, life and spirituality, which are deeply loved by the Indian people.
